Photographer’s Note
We were all waiting. Like parishoners at mass waiting for communion. We had all come out of the windswept, wet, cold, east, on a rare day of sun. We had come to the west end of America to watch a giant 5 billion year old nuclear fusion reaction as it set into the Pacific Ocean. The gulls were watching too. Then it was gone, gone to lighten the other side of the globe. And we turned to walk back on the dark cold beach for the long drive back home.
